On July 22 2011 16:18 typingit wrote: to get it working with 1.3.5 :
just use option 2, change to your original installation.
edit the .bat file and find 18574 and add 19132 after it.
save/close the .bat file, run the localizer, choose option 1, choose a region, and you are good to go. mines working on tw/us/sea with 1.3.5

try running option 1 back to your original language, then option 3 for a clean install.
goto your sc2 folder, delete all the extra language files. ie - if you have the US client, and were relocalizing to KR, put koKR in the search box, delete all files.
That *should* put your sc2 folder back to default, then you can run the editted .bat file and it should work fine and allow you to change your locale.
If that doesn't work, you could always reinstall and run the editted .bat file. Or wait for the update.

So manually patching the version 15 of the relocalizer has worked for a lot of people. I think those that are left just need a good clean install and to use the temp upgraded version of the relocalizer. I just made the changes in the relocalizer and posted it for you to try.
1) Clean however you want, I suggest clean install or clean install files that you have backed up (i just always backup the entire directory before using the relocalizaer). 2) Upgrade the installation to 1.3.5 and test by trying to login to the game and make sure you get the, "you need a language pack error". 3) Download the temporary relocalizer upgraded for the 1.3.5 release and run.
